If my floor feels dry to the touch, is the water damage really fixed?
No. 'Dry to the touch' is a surface condition. For structural materials to be truly dry, their internal moisture content must reach a psychrometric equilibrium with the ambient air. The IICRC S500 standard of care for McGregor Isles targets a drying goal of 40 Grains Per Pound (GPP) at 70°F, which is a measure of vapor pressure in the air. Unbalanced vapor pressure drives moisture into wall cavities and subfloors, leading to hidden secondary damage.

What is the single most important thing I should do before help arrives?
Safely shut off the water source at the main valve and electricity at the breaker panel. How quickly do I need to act to prevent mold after a leak?
Act within the 48–72 hour window. This is the established timeframe for mold colonization to begin on wet organic materials. My insurance says the floodwater is 'Category 3.' What does that mean for my claim?
Category 3 water, often from storm surge or groundwater intrusion in Zone AE, is grossly contaminated (black water) and poses a significant health hazard. Restoration requires full containment, antimicrobial application, and disposal of porous materials.
